A collection of essays about prominent British authors, many of which are also written by prominent authors (Graham Green on Fielding and Sterne, T.S. Eliot on Byron, Leonard Woolf on Tom Paine, etc.). Errata laid in indicating that "The Publisher's wish to point out that this book has no relation to another under the same title by H.M. Vaughan, the existence of which had escaped their notice until after the publication of this volume."
